Why do I need a separate pool inspection when buying a home?

General home inspectors often do not have the specialized knowledge required to evaluate complex pool equipment and structural integrity. Hiring a dedicated pool professional ensures no costly deficiencies are overlooked.

What does a realtor pool inspection include?

Our comprehensive pool inspections include a detailed visual evaluation of the pool’s interior surface, decking, coping, and the entire equipment pad, including pumps, filters, and heaters.

How long does a typical real estate pool inspection take?

A thorough evaluation usually takes between one and two hours, depending on the size of the pool, the complexity of the equipment, and whether a spa is included.

What specific spa components do you evaluate?

During a spa inspection, we meticulously check the heaters, air blowers, jet functionality, filtration systems, and the structural integrity of the spa shell.

Do you check the pool automation systems?

Yes, we review all control panels, timers, and smart features to ensure the automation systems are communicating correctly with your pumps and heaters.

How do you assess the condition of the pool surface?

We perform a thorough visual check of the plaster, pebble, or fiberglass surface to look for signs of cracking, extreme scaling, or delamination that could compromise the pool structure.
